Anjuman condoles Rahat Indori’s death
KT NEWS SERVICE. Dated: 8/13/2020 1:16:25 PM
JAMMU, Aug 12: In a specially convened meeting of AnjumanFarogh-e-Urdu Jammu & Kashmir by its president Amin Banihali the death of the reputed and celebrated poet of the Sub-Continent, RahatIndori, was condoled.
A statement of the Anjuman hailed RahatIndori as a poet who for the last 50 years have earned lot of appreciation and gratitude in mushairas both by elders and youngsters and was sought after personality for the success of mushaira where in the audience would tirelessly sit till hours in the morning. He has rightly been described as “lootera of mushiaras” by Gulzar, the statement said.
The Anjuman secretary, Khurshid Kazmi said that RahatIndori was amongst those poets/ writers of Urdu world who had the fearlessness and boldness to say whatever they wanted to communicate. He had said at the height of protests regarding anti-CAA without caring for the consequences, he had courageously and aptly said: “Sabhi ka khoonshamilhaiyahankimattimein/ Kisi kebaap ka Hindustan thodahai.”
The Anjuman statement said that RahatIndori’s death is a great loss to the Urdu fraternity and that he would be missed in the mushairas. Quoting his verse “Ab na main hoonbaqinabaqizamane mere/ Phir be sherunmeinmashoorheinfasane mere,” the statement said that he will continue to live in the poetry he leaves behind.
Anjuman prayed that his soul rest in peace and the bereaved family and his countless fans get the strength to bear this great loss.
